Trion has gone a perfect 4-0 against Rome rec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Wednesday. The Bulldogs will look to defend their home field against the Wolves at 5:30 p.m. Trion will be looking to extend their current five-game winning streak.
Trion barely beat Lakeview-Fort Oglethorpe the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Bulldogs put the hurt on the Warriors with a sharp 12-3 win on Tuesday. The result was nothing new for the Bulldogs, who have now won nine contests by six runs or more so far this season.
Meanwhile, Tuesday just wasn't the day for Rome's offense. They lost 18-0 to Villa Rica on Tuesday. The Wolves have struggled against the Wildcats recently, as the game was their eighth consecutive lost matchup.
Trion's victory bumped their record up to 13-5. As for Rome, their loss dropped their record down to 8-14.
Trion took their win against Rome in their previous meeting back in August by a conclusive 13-0 score. Do the Bulldogs have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Wolves tur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
